PLEASE HURRY I ONLY HAVE 5MIN TO TURN IT IN!!! A new television set was recently purchased for a common Room and a resident Hall

for $446.90 including tax. If the tax rate is 9%, find the price of the television set before taxes.

Answer:

The price of the tv before tax is 410

Step-by-step explanation:

Let x = price of tv before tax

tax = x*  9%

tax = .09x

The total cost is price of tv before tax plus tax

total cost = x + .09x

total cost = 1.09x

446.90 = 1.09x

Divide each side by 1.09

446.90/1.09 = 1.09x/1.09

410 = x

The price of the tv before tax is 410
